On the Colorado Avalanche side, the top scorer is Mikko Rantanen, right winger with 92 points, with 36 goals and 56 assists. Center Nathan MacKinnon is second in the ranking with 88 points, with 32 goals and 56 assists.
Look at them!
Roman Josi, Swiss defender, is the top scorer for the Nashville Predators. There are 96 points in the regular season, with 23 goals and 73 assists. Number that placed the player in the fifth position in the ranking of players with the most assists in the league. Matt Duchene, the team's center, is second on the team's top scorers list. There are 86 points, with 43 goals and 43 assists.

How does the Colorado Avalanche arrive?
- The Colorado Avalanche finished the season leading the Western Conference with 119 points, 56 wins and 19 losses. The Denver team's campaign was second best overall, second only to the Florida Panthers, who won 122 in the Eastern Conference. Colorado's last matches were not good. The recent 10-game track record is anything but encouraging. There were six defeats and only four victories.

How the Nashville Predators arrive?
The Nashville team finished the regular season in eighth position in the Western Conference with 97 points, with 45 wins and 30 losses. Among the teams that are in the NHL playoffs, the team led by John Hynes is the only one that has not reached 100 points. In the last 10 games, a very uneven campaign. There were six defeats and four victories. They won the Colorado Avalanche in that period away from home by 5-4.
